In case you don't know, the regular HTML for things like that is:

Bold: <b>Text goes here</b>
Italics: <i>Text goes here</i>
Underline: <u>Text goes here</u>
Strikethrough: <s>Text goes here</s>
Image: <img src="URL of Image" />
Link: <a href="URL">Link Text goes here</a>
